Luxury Ironwork

When you think of memorable  country estates  you often think of the wonderful Wrought iron Gates that grace the pillared entrances .  The gate is truly the welcome mat to the property . In Years past there was alot of thought that went into the design of the elegant scrollwork and interesting  ornaments to give the visual effect that the deigners and Architects where envisioning. Often Times they were utilizing designs that  traveled from the French and English countryside and reached back centuries  . The Architect and Clients   love of this art form of the forge was   a true transending  collaboration. Wrought iron was a standard of luxury  and clientsthat were building  exclusive residences needed the security and the elegance that the metal would provide. The wonderful hand made gate is hard to come by today but with the right Designer and Artist Blacksmith this  is still possible.  When one views  a Hand forged gate  it celebrates your arrival and  you get a sense of tradition and perminence.  You can feel the hammermarks of the craftsman  that are frozen in time .  It is the uniqeness  of its one of a kind   surface and texture  incororated in  the finished  product that  is the true rareity .

How to hand forge a Wrought iron. Hobbit door hinge.

IMG_9653Hammersmith Studios Just Recently completed a  Decorative Hand forged Wrought iron hinge for a customer . We could not be more pleased with the outcome. It was designed by Hammmersmith Studios  for a Children’ s play room and was a main focal point for the interior design concept. The material chosen for the hinge was three sixteenth thick mild steel and was embellish with decorative motifs such as leaves and funny little creaturesto create a sense of whimsy.  there where some interesting challenges with this project such as properly aligning the hinge barrels so as to allow the door to swing level. after any hour of tweaking and adjusting it worked perfectly and the Customer had it installed for his holiday party and after all that what it is all about . What is hand Forged Architectural Ironwork?

Sometimes we get questions about our work . Lets face it  Hand forged Architectural ironwork isn’t usually the hot  topic of  many cocktail parties.   There is a lot of confusion about what it is and what it is not..Architectural ironwork is a term used to designate any metalwork that embellishes building or structures and is added  for safety and functional art . The main uses include Hand railings Driveway gates , Window grills  , Balcony brackets.   Hand forged ironwork is  also another term that can be quite confusing to some people. If you are interested in Hand forged iron work  than you should be looking  for a Architectural blacksmith company versus a  blacksmith . A general blacksmith my have the skill to forged work such as hinges and door hardware or kitchen accessories but may not have the Special skills or expertise to create larger scale work such as railing and gates.  Also they may not understand how to incorporate the correct design vocabulary into the project to arrive  at a balanced design.   Architectural  ironwork is a product that really has to work and funImagection properly, but just as important it has to look right with the building and its surroundings.   The hand forged designation means that the work is formed using hammers and Anvils   after it has been heated in a Blacksmiths forge or Furnace to approximately 1800 degrees.   Be Sure to ask the craftsman about the shop and the  tools  they use and if possible take a tour of their ,shop you will find it a fascinating place to see.,

Some elemental points on Boston ironwork . By HammersmithStudios

 Some elemental points on  Boston ironwork . By HammersmithStudios

Boston’s Wrought ironwork has a very distinctive flavor . It is Decidedly English in Nature. The work produced by the working blacksmiths and Wrought iron craftsmen were from Old world stock and truly understood the design vocabulary of the designs set out by the Architects of the Boston Area. In particular they were well versed in the decorative style of the Georgian style English work with its very straight laced decorative designs and the use of rectangle stock was all hints to its origins. Another important feature was the use of Repousse foliage and Acanthus leafwork .The leaf work was of a more stout material as to be able to withstand the ravages of the Boston Weather. Decorative banding or collars were for the most part made in a more molding shape versus the flat stock type. the use of mechanical fasteners such as screws and rivets were used for all fittings of the structure of the gates or fences . Some other interesting decorative elements employed were things such as flame twist and hand forged picket points with very fancy spire or obelisk shapes as finials which were very common on the better work produced.
